Tour description

We'll see you at Notre-Dame de la Garde . From that point, we will begin our itinerary admiring the impressive Romanesque-Byzantine style façade of the basilica, the most important monument in the city!
After learning about its history and interesting details, we will enjoy the magnificent panoramic views of Marseille from where we can appreciate the stadium, the Old Port, the hills of the Calanques National Park, the Frioul Islands, among others.
A very noticeable point is the view that we will have of the island of If , which plays an important role in the novel by Alexandre Dumas, "The Count of Monte Cristo".

Next, we will begin the descent towards the city center passing through:

  • Parc Pierre Puget and the old Latin quarter , where the remains of the ancient Roman necropolis of Massilia are located.
  • The house of the French activist Berty Albrecht, who fought against the Nazi occupation in the country.
  • We will pass by the oldest bakery in the country.


Finally , we will conclude our tour enjoying the panoramic views from the Palais du Pharo Park.
